Is a metal roof noisy when it rains?

Much less than people expect. Over solid decking with underlayment, a Long Prairie metal roof sounds about like a shingle roof from inside. The loud tin roof people remember was screwed to open purlins on a barn.

What does a metal roof cost in Long Prairie?

Most Long Prairie metal roof jobs land between about $12,000 and $30,000 in 2026, depending on square footage, pitch, panel type and how much tear off is involved. Standing seam runs higher than exposed fastener panels. We measure before we quote and the estimate is free.

What colors can I choose from?

Around twenty standard colors. Green, burgundy, bronze, black, gray, tan and barn red are the ones most Long Prairie homeowners land on. We bring the chart with the estimate so you can hold it against your siding.

How long does the installation take?

A straightforward Long Prairie house is usually three to five days. A cut up roof with dormers, valleys and multiple pitches takes longer, because every panel and trim piece gets measured and fit on site.
